Underbrush Clearing in Salt Lake City, UT
Underbrush clearing services involve removing dense growth of shrubs, small trees, and overgrown vegetation from residential properties. This work is often requested for projects such as preparing a yard for landscaping, reducing fire hazards, or restoring the appearance of a neglected area. Property owners typically want to understand the extent of clearing needed, the types of plants involved, and how the process might impact existing trees or structures on the property.
Before requesting underbrush clearing, homeowners should consider the size and density of the area to be cleared, as well as any local regulations or restrictions related to vegetation removal. Knowing the scope of the project helps in planning the work effectively and ensures that the desired results are achieved. Clarifying whether debris will be removed or left on-site can also influence the overall process and final appearance of the property.

Common Underbrush Clearing Jobs
Brush Removal - clearing overgrown areas to improve yard appearance and safety.
Thicket Clearing - removing dense underbrush to create open space for landscaping or recreation.
Fence Line Clearing - trimming or removing underbrush along property boundaries for better access and visibility.
Trail and Path Clearing - maintaining clear walkways through wooded or overgrown areas.
Firebreak Clearing - reducing combustible vegetation to help prevent wildfires.
Yard Cleanup - tidying up overgrown areas to enhance curb appeal and property value.
Underbrush Clearing Questions
What is underbrush clearing? Underbrush clearing involves removing shrubs, small trees, and dense vegetation to improve visibility, safety, and property appearance.
Why is underbrush removal important? Clearing underbrush reduces fire risk, prevents pest habitats, and creates more usable outdoor space.
What types of projects typically require underbrush clearing? Projects include preparing land for construction, creating pathways, managing overgrown yards, or maintaining firebreaks.
How does underbrush clearing benefit property owners? It enhances curb appeal, increases safety, and helps maintain a healthy landscape by reducing unwanted vegetation.
